Opinion: The Financial Software as a Service ManifestoThis is a featured page

What is Software as a Service?
Traditionally companies buy, licence or build the software that they need and install it on their own computers and networks. They manage both the business process and the technology that supports it themselves. We call this On-Premise software. Typically On-Premise software is licensed at the start of a project with an on-going maintenance fee for support and new releases.

The SaaS approach is different. The customer is responsible for the business process, but the provider is responsible for the technology and its support. The application runs at the provider's facility and is based on a common set of code and data definitions consumed by customers in a one-to-many model. This is often termed 'muliti-tenancy' and refers to the fact that the provider makes the code available for consumption in a single instance to multiple clients. The service is usually paid for on an inclusive subscription basis and most providers let their customers discontinue at a month's notice. This means that retaining customers requires a laser focus on service.

Why should it be important to the financial management community?
SaaS provides an alternate model for delivering business processes. The most important difference is that a SaaS approach can help the customer or practice collaborate with staff, business partners and clients in ways that would be difficult or impossible with the On-Premise approach. Partners can have controlled access to a customer's system. Practices can easily share data with their clients, or analyse their entire client base to provide additional services, where the analysis would be very difficult across multiple physical locations or instances of the software.

What benefits can SaaS offer?
  • Implementation is generally much quicker than On-Premise and training costs are often lower because training occurs much closer to the point of service delivery.
  • The software never requires customer maintenance. That is the service provider's responsibility. All bug fixes, patches and new features simply 'turn up.' This avoids the many problems associated with On-Premise updates.
  • The one-to-many architecture allows some economies of scale and cost savings to be shared amongst the community of users. In addition the management of the IT environment is changed so that the SaaS customer only needs to support a basic, Internet connected device with a web browser. That means so-called legacy PCs can have a much longer useful life.
  • The versioning issues associated with exchanging data files and worrying about software versions disappears.
  • In addition, the practice or the client can now consider outsourcing some of the routine transaction recording work to lower cost locations.

What are the risks and concerns?
Some people have expressed concerns over data security and the risk of service outtages. Most SaaS providers will offer similar access security to Internet banking, and a Service Level Agreement (SLA) which guarantees a better than 99% availability. A provider's backup and recovery strategy is usually much more comprehensive compared to that applied in on-premise scenarios. Overall, this should mean the risks associated with software are reduced. There are similar risks and concerns over the long term viability of the vendor compared to a traditional software company, but most providers allow easy access to data for import and export. Provider switching is therefore much easier than with On-Premise providers.

What should you look for from a potential SaaS partner?
  • Check that functionality matches your needs. Most SaaS providers are in 'early stage' development and do not offer all the bells and whistles found in other applications. But then they don't have the bloat that goes with it.
  • Review the track record and reference sites. It can take 2 to 3 years to establish a stable SaaS business.
  • Look for a "try before you buy" option. A good SaaS provider should have no fear of giving you a test run to check things out before you sign up.
  • Check online performance. SaaS providers architect solutions for the web rather than retrofit. There is a palpable difference.
  • Look for configurability. There should be options to configure your user environment for your particular business.
  • Look for comprehensive service delivery. This should handle easy set up of new users, new companies, and configuration of user access for different levels of user.
  • Review online help options, and an automated approach to tracking helpdesk issues. Obtain a copy of the SLA which should guarantee 99+% availability?
  • Finally, look for open APIs that make it easy for you to import and export data and connect the provider's web service to other services. The better SaaS providers realise that integration of different services is one of SaaS's key advantages.


Is SaaS right for you?
The rise of vendors like Winweb (118,000 users), Twinfield (25,000 users), Liberty Accounts and FreshBooks (135,000) users, all in the SMB space provides a strong leading indicator that SaaS has demonstrated value and fitness in the market. Salesforce.com, used by many SMBs for CRM, has achieved success with enterprises implementing thousands of users. Whether SaaS is right for your business is another matter.

In follow on articles we will extend the manifesto to discuss customer use cases from various SaaS vendors. As well as explaining how they are using their particular web service, we'll be highlighting the key reasons why they chose this approach over a conventional, on-premise solution.

For further reading, here are links to useful articles that give more detail and background on the SaaS topic:

From Nigel Harris of AccountingWEB:

Online accounting services buyer's guide

From Phil Wainewright of ZDnet:

SoSaaS: Same old Software, as a Service

Seeking the true meaning of SaaS

What to look for in a SaaS vendor

In SaaS, does trust depend on purity?

From Frederick Chong, Gianpaolo Carraro, and Roger Wolter of Microsoft:

Multi-Tenant Data Architecture

From Jim Holincheck of Gartner:

Clearing Up the Confusion About SaaS


david_terrar
david_terrar
Latest page update: made by david_terrar , Mar 18 2007, 5:06 AM EDT (about this update About This Update david_terrar correction on SLA % - david_terrar

2 words added
2 words deleted

view changes

- complete history)
More Info: links to this page
Started By Thread Subject Replies Last Post
jstokdyk Relax about the length 5 Mar 4 2007, 5:02 AM EST by david_terrar
Thread started: Mar 2 2007, 6:40 AM EST  Watch
After all, you are writing for an electronic medium, so we are not slaves to the word count.

The real test is whether the article compels you to keep reading - because you are forcing someone to carry out a phyiscal activity (scroll down the screen) to keep them involved. I found this a good summary and welcome the bulleted bits - they drive home the argument more effectively than long, logically perfect paragraphs.

If you are still wondering what to do and where to go with the "is SaaS right for you?" section, remember that I did offer the opporunity to extend your manifesto into a subsequent piece or two - and the "is it right for you?" discussion is an important one to get readers to think about. If you all have the time/enthusiasm, you could expand that element with short summaries from a selection of different vendors' customers about why the selected system was right for them - try to aim for a wide spread of user types and reasons for embracing SaaS. Again, aim for c600 words (give or take a hundred).

If you do decide to go this route, I would include a final summary paragraph with the heading "Is SaaS right for you?" with a slimmed down final paragraph and a trailer that the next installment of the manifesto will answer the question more fully and include explanations from users why they chose this route...

After some fast drafting/editing work and I suspect a big investment of emotion and effort, you've managed to convince me that wiki drafting tools aren't quiet as rubbish as I iniitally suggested. Well done!
Do you find this valuable?    
Keyword tags: None
Show Last Reply
david_terrar On Dennis's revision 0 Mar 2 2007, 6:04 AM EST by david_terrar
Thread started: Mar 2 2007, 6:04 AM EST  Watch
Like the bullets. Will have a proper read during the day.... Looks good, though not sure about your "is SaaS right for you" emphasis... maybe we can debate that when I've thought about it. Hopefully John will let us stretch up from 500 words (this is just over 900).
Do you find this valuable?    
Keyword tags: None
dahowlett Does Wetpaint provide 1 Feb 28 2007, 1:47 PM EST by david_terrar
Thread started: Feb 28 2007, 12:21 PM EST  Watch
proper version control?
Do you find this valuable?    
Keyword tags: None
Show Last Reply
Showing 3 of 5 threads for this page - view all

Related Content

  (what's this?Related ContentThanks to keyword tags, links to related pages and threads are added to the bottom of your pages. Up to 15 links are shown, determined by matching tags and by how recently the content was updated; keeping the most current at the top. Share your feedback on Wetpaint Central.)